Write the following rational numbers with positive denominators:
`(-17)/(-13)`
Advertisements
उत्तर
`(-17)/(-13)` can be written as = `(-17 xx (-1))/(-13 xx (-1)) = 17/13`, as both negative signs are cancelled.
